165 Monogamy, In This Economy? with Laura Boyle


Listen Later

Money, parenting, sharing space, schedules, rental agreements… these may not be the sexiest and most exciting aspects of non-monogamy, but they are important. In fact, they’re common stumbling blocks, and can cause big relationship issues when left unaddressed for long periods of time.

Here’s the problem: we rarely get to hear about how other polyamorous people are handling the practical details of their lives. That’s exactly what our guest today, author and coach Laura Boyle, is out to solve. Her new book, Monogamy? In this Economy? Finances, Childrearing, and Other Practical Concerns of Polyamory, is based on a survey of nearly 500 polyamorous households and is chock full of the real-life experiences of families with more than two adults.

In this episode, we’re talking about:

— The most common size of polyamorous households (hint: it's not what you might expect!)

— Creative solutions for managing space constraints in shared living situations

— The importance of open communication about seemingly minor issues before they become major problems

— How to navigate the complexities of blending families and introducing new partners to children

— Practical considerations around finances, particularly regarding vacations and large gifts for non-nesting partners

— The parallels between polyamorous family dynamics and other "non-traditional" family structures like blended families

— Why it's crucial to discuss reproductive health and pregnancy scenarios early in relationships

— Our own experiences with solving these issues

— How relationship anarchy principles can benefit both monogamous and non-monogamous relationships

— Addressing jealousy in multi-adult households without overemphasizing or ignoring it
